Climate Change in the Rainforest
Climate models predict that local temperatures in Queensland, Australia, will rise about 3.5° Celsius in the next century, resulting in a nearly 50% extinction rate among animals found only in the Wet Tropics World Heritage Area. Richardo Montiel (Reyðarfjörður, Iceland) and César Zuleta (Székesfehérvár, Hungary) will help measure the distribution and abundance of animals in this area to assess the impact of climate change.
